Eliminations for oratorical, storytelling contest underway

THE elimination for the Socsksargen-wide oratorical and storytelling contest is underway, with the final round slated for July 2006 during South Cotabato's T'nalak festival.

The Sarangani leg of the elimination round was held last November 26 at the provincial capitol grounds in Alabel, in time for the province's Muna To Festival.

Eight high school students and seven elementary pupils, each representing the municipalities in Sarangani, vied for the oratorical and storytelling contests.

The contest, which is sponsored by DepEd Sarangani, Bombo-Gensan, Socsksargen Multi-Sectoral Coalition for Sustainable Mineral Development and Sagittarius Mines, Inc. is an annual event that aims to promote the concept of development partnership and responsible mining among the youth.

Elimination in Tacurong City and Sultan Kudarat province were already done last 16 September and 18 November, respectively. The elimination rounds for General Santos City, Koronadal City and South Cotabato are slated early next year. (Press release)
